Minecraft 是一款風靡全球的游戲。Minecraft 在全球擁有數(shù)百萬玩家,因此許多人希望創(chuàng)建自己的 Minecraft 服務器來與朋友一起玩或創(chuàng)建玩家社區(qū)也就不足為奇了。設置 Minecraft 服務器似乎是一項艱巨的任務,但有了正確的工具和指導,它可以成為一種簡單而愉快的體驗。
在本文中,我們將為您提供有關如何從頭開始設置 Minecraft 服務器的綜合指南。我們將涵蓋您需要了解的所有內(nèi)容,從安裝和配置 Linux 服務器到設置您的 Minecraft 服務器并使其可供其他人訪問。我們還將向您展示如何從流行的 Minecraft 游戲服務器提供商 GPORTAL 租用已經(jīng)準備好的服務器。無論您是經(jīng)驗豐富的服務器管理員還是初學者,本終極指南都將幫助您為您和您的朋友創(chuàng)建完美的 Minecraft 服務器。所以,坐下來,喝杯咖啡,讓我們開始創(chuàng)建您自己的 Minecraft 服務器的激動人心的旅程。
在您的 PC 上自行托管 Minecraft 服務器的優(yōu)缺點
優(yōu)點
- 自定義:您可以完全控制您的服務器,并可以根據(jù)自己的喜好對其進行自定義,包括選擇模組、插件和游戲模式。
- 性能:根據(jù)您 PC 的硬件,您可能可以獲得比共享托管服務器更好的性能,因為您不必與其他用戶共享資源。
缺點
- 經(jīng)濟高效:如果您 24/7 全天候運行您的 PC,與僅租用游戲服務器相比,在您的 PC 上托管您自己的服務器可能會非常昂貴。
- 安全性:在您的 PC 上托管服務器可能會使其容易受到網(wǎng)絡攻擊,您可能需要投資防火墻和防病毒軟件等安全措施來保護您的計算機。
- 技術專長:設置和維護 Minecraft 服務器可能很復雜,您可能需要具備技術專長才能有效地管理它。
- 資源使用:在您的 PC 上運行服務器會消耗大量資源,例如 CPU、RAM 和帶寬,這會降低您的計算機速度并影響您可能正在運行的其他應用程序。
- 可靠性:您服務器的可靠性取決于您的互聯(lián)網(wǎng)連接和您電腦的穩(wěn)定性。任何停電、網(wǎng)絡問題或硬件故障都可能導致服務器停機。
在租用服務器上自行托管 Minecraft 服務器的優(yōu)缺點
自托管 Minecraft 服務器對于那些想要完全控制其服務器并希望根據(jù)自己的喜好對其進行自定義的人來說是一個不錯的選擇。但是,它也有其優(yōu)點和缺點。
優(yōu)點
- 完全控制:自托管讓您可以完全控制您的服務器。您可以根據(jù)自己的喜好自定義它,添加插件,并根據(jù)需要對其進行管理。
- 成本更低:自托管比租用服務器更便宜。
- 無限制:當您自行托管時,對玩家數(shù)量或您可以使用的資源量沒有限制。您可以擁有任意數(shù)量的玩家,并且可以根據(jù)需要分配資源。
缺點
- 所需的技術知識:自托管需要一些技術知識。您需要知道如何安裝和配置服務器、管理安全性以及解決可能出現(xiàn)的任何問題。
- 維護:對于自托管,您負責維護服務器。這可能很耗時,并且需要定期更新和備份。
- 安全風險:當您自行托管時,您有責任管理服務器的安全性。這包括設置防火墻、管理用戶權限以及使軟件保持最新。未能正確保護您的服務器可能會導致安全漏洞和數(shù)據(jù)丟失。
- 有限支持:當您從托管服務提供商處租用 Minecraft 服務器時,您可以獲得技術支持。使用自托管,您可以自行解決問題。
租用 Minecraft 服務器的優(yōu)缺點
租用 Minecraft 服務器是那些想要無憂體驗且不想處理自托管技術細節(jié)的人的熱門選擇。但是,它也有其優(yōu)點和缺點。以下是租用 Minecraft 服務器的一些主要優(yōu)點和缺點:
優(yōu)點
- 設置簡單:租用服務器非常容易設置。您不需要任何技術知識,托管服務提供商會為您處理一切。
- 技術支持:托管服務提供商提供技術支持,因此如果您遇到任何問題,您可以快速輕松地獲得幫助。
- 可擴展性:租用服務器可以讓您根據(jù)需要輕松擴展或縮小。如果您需要更多資源或玩家,您可以在不停機的情況下升級您的包裹。
- 安全性:托管服務提供商管理服務器安全性,因此您無需擔心管理防火墻或保持軟件最新。
缺點
- 成本:租用服務器可能比自托管更昂貴,尤其是當您有大量玩家時。
- 有限的控制:租用服務器會限制您對服務器的控制。您可能無法安裝某些插件或對服務器設置進行某些更改。
- 資源限制:托管服務提供商可能會限制您可以使用的資源量,例如 RAM 或 CPU 使用率。這會限制您可以在服務器上擁有的玩家數(shù)量或您可以擁有的活動量。
- 停機時間:托管服務提供商可能會遇到停機時間,這可能會導致您的服務器在一段時間內(nèi)不可用。
現(xiàn)在您已經(jīng)了解了 Minecraft 服務器的每種托管方法的優(yōu)缺點,接下來由您來決定了。但無論您做出什么決定:在本文中,我們將介紹這兩種方法。讓我們從自托管開始。
自托管 Minecraft 服務器(手動)
本章既適用于在租用的 Linux 服務器上安裝 Minecraft 服務器,也適用于在具有基于 Linux 的操作系統(tǒng)的 PC 上本地運行它。
在開始實際安裝 Minecraft 服務器之前,您需要先滿足一些要求:
要求
- 具有基于 Linux 的操作系統(tǒng)和足夠資源的服務器(我們至少推薦我們的VPS M SSD)
- 通過 SSH 和 Root 訪問您的服務器
安裝所需的包
為了讓您的 Minecraft 服務器正常工作,需要一些軟件包。在我們的示例中,我們使用帶有 Debian 10 的 Linux 服務器作為操作系統(tǒng)。因此,請記住,某些命令可能會因您的操作系統(tǒng)而異。
使用以下命令安裝所需的軟件包:
apt install screen wget –y
安裝Java
Java 是運行您自己的 Minecraft 服務器的關鍵組件之一。為正確的 Minecraft 版本安裝正確的 Java 版本也很重要。在下表中,您將找到不同的 Minecraft 版本以及您需要安裝的相應 Java 版本:
我的世界版本 | 所需的 Java 版本 |
1.7.10 – 1.16.5 | Java 8 |
1.17.x | Java 16 |
1.18+ | Java 17 |
在我們的示例中,我將設置一個運行最新版本 Minecraft 的服務器,即今天的 Minecraft 1.19.3。因此需要 Java 17。
為了安裝 Java 17,執(zhí)行以下命令,命令后命令:
mkdir /usr/java
cd /usr/java
wget https://download.java.net/java/GA/jdk17.0.1/2a2082e5a09d4267845be086888add4f/12/GPL/openjdk-17.0.1_linux-x64_bin.tar.gz
tar xvf openjdk-17.0.1_linux-x64_bin.tar.gz
rm openjdk-17*.tar.gz
mv jdk-17*/ /usr/java
mv jdk-17* jdk-17
sudo update-alternatives --install /usr/bin/java java /usr/java/jdk-17/bin/java 20000
專業(yè)提示:如果您想稍后安裝不同的 Minecraft 版本,因此需要安裝不同的 Java 版本,請使用此命令在活動的 Java 版本之間切換:
sudo update-alternatives --config java
將彈出此菜單:

在這里您可以看到每個已安裝的 Java 版本。通過輸入相應的數(shù)字,您可以更改激活的版本(例如 Java 8 為 3)
下載 Minecraft 服務器文件
在我們開始下載我們需要的文件之前,讓我們快速創(chuàng)建一個單獨的文件夾,我們的 Minecraft 實例將在其中運行。
你可以在任何你想要的地方創(chuàng)建這個文件夾,但我更喜歡在主目錄中創(chuàng)建。因此,我將使用以下命令在那里創(chuàng)建一個文件夾:
mkdir /home/Minecraft
創(chuàng)建文件夾后,讓我們使用以下命令切換到該文件夾??:
cd /home/Minecraft
現(xiàn)在是時候下載實際的 Minecraft 服務器文件了。
現(xiàn)在右鍵單擊“minecraft_server.1.19.3.jar”并選擇“復制鏈接地址”
專業(yè)提示:如果您想為不同/舊版本設置服務器,只需谷歌“Minecraft [VERSION] 服務器下載”以下載相應的 jar 文件。
要將文件直接下載到我們的服務器,我們可以使用 wget——我們之前安裝的包。為此,請在您的控制臺中鍵入“wget”并粘貼您從 Minecraft 網(wǎng)站復制的鏈接,右鍵單擊并按回車鍵。
創(chuàng)建啟動腳本
現(xiàn)在我們需要創(chuàng)建一個腳本來啟動我們的服務器。為此,請使用此命令創(chuàng)建腳本:
nano start.sh
并粘貼以下內(nèi)容:
screen -S Minecraft java -Xms512M -Xmx4G -jar server.jar
粘貼內(nèi)容后,使用[CTRL+O]保存文件并使用[CTRL+X]退出編輯器。
專家提示:
如有需要,請修改:
- Xms表示您要分配的最小RAM 量
- Xmx表示您要分配的?最大RAM 數(shù)量
此外,讓我們通過使用以下命令創(chuàng)建一個名為 eula.txt 的文件來接受 EULA(最終用戶許可協(xié)議):
nano eula.txt
并粘貼以下內(nèi)容:
eula=true
粘貼內(nèi)容后,使用[CTRL+O]保存文件并使用[CTRL+X]退出編輯器。
在最后一步中,我們將使用以下命令使腳本可執(zhí)行:
chmod +x start.sh
啟動我的世界服務器
現(xiàn)在終于可以啟動我們的服務器了。為此,請使用以下命令:
./start.sh
專家提示:
因為我們的 Minecraft 實例在屏幕會話中運行,服務器將繼續(xù)運行,即使我們關閉我們的控制臺/關閉我們用于連接到遠程服務器的 PC。
如果你想關閉 Minecraft 控制臺(例如你想在你的 Linux 服務器上做一些其他事情,使用 [CTRL+A]+D 關閉(分離)控制臺。
如果你想再次打開它(重新連接),使用這個命令:
screen –rx
恭喜!您的 Minecraft 服務器已啟動并正在運行。如果這對您來說太復雜,但您仍想自托管您的 Minecraft 服務器,我們?yōu)槟榻B了下一個自托管方法!
自托管Minecraft服務器(使用腳本)
此方法適合所有想利用自托管 Minecraft 服務器并完全控制服務器的優(yōu)勢,但發(fā)現(xiàn)執(zhí)行上述步驟太復雜的人。?我們將使用 realTM 的“mcserver_installer”——一種開源、強大且廣泛的 Bash 腳本,用于在您的 Linux 服務器上安裝 Minecraft 服務器。
先決條件/要求
- 具有受支持的 Linux 發(fā)行版(Debian 和 Ubuntu)和足夠資源的 Linux 服務器(我們至少推薦我們的VPS M SSD)
- 對 Linux 服務器的 Root 和 SSH 訪問
下載腳本
為了下載腳本,需要在您的服務器上安裝 git-package。要安裝它,請使用:
apt install git –y
現(xiàn)在使用此命令下載腳本:
git clone https://github.com/officialrealTM/mcserver_installer.git
運行腳本
下載腳本后,使用以下命令進入其目錄:
cd mcserver_installer
并使用此命令執(zhí)行腳本:
./mcserver_installer.sh
第一次啟動腳本時,它要安裝一些必需的包。點擊“是”繼續(xù)。

此過程可能需要一些時間才能完成。
在初始設置過程之后,腳本會詢問您要安裝哪種類型的 Minecraft 服務器。從現(xiàn)在開始,這將是您每次啟動腳本時都會獲得的菜單。

如您所見,此腳本可以安裝 Minecraft Vanilla、Forge、Spigot 和 Paper 服務器。在這種情況下,我們將選擇“Minecraft Vanilla”——因此我們按回車鍵選擇它。
現(xiàn)在它會提示我們輸入要在服務器上安裝的確切 Minecraft 版本:

我們將選擇截至今天的最新版本,即 1.19.3
專業(yè)提示:以正確的格式輸入版本號很重要,否則會導致錯誤。還要確保輸入受支持的 Minecraft 版本(從 1.7.x 到 1.19+,沒有快照版本)
該腳本會自動檢測到要運行 Minecraft 1.19.3 服務器,需要 Java 17 并詢問您是否要安裝它:

點擊“是”進行安裝。此過程需要一些時間才能完成。安裝完成后,您可以選擇預定義的 RAM 量分配給您的 Minecraft 服務器或設置自定義量。

專業(yè)提示:如果您不想在服務器上運行除 Minecraft 服務器之外的任何東西,您可以分配最多 75% 的 Linux 服務器 RAM。在這個例子中,我們的 VPS M SSD 有 16GB 的內(nèi)存,所以我們最多可以為服務器分配 12GB 的內(nèi)存。如果你想在你的 Linux 服務器上運行除 Minecraft 服務器之外的其他東西,我們建議你為 Minecraft 服務器分配不超過 50% 的內(nèi)存——所以在我們的例子中,不要超過 8GB。選擇 RAM 量后,您的 Minecraft 服務器已設置完畢。

您的服務器已保存在顯示的目錄中。要啟動它,請轉到此目錄。在我們的示例中使用此命令:
cd Servers/Minecraft-1.19.3
要啟動服務器,請使用以下命令:
./start.sh
恭喜!您的 Minecraft 1.19.3 服務器在 3 分鐘內(nèi)啟動并運行!
租用 Minecraft 服務器
如果您不想處理所有配置,只想立即開始與您的朋友一起玩,租用 Minecraft 服務器是一個可行的選擇。在本指南中,我們將向您展示如何在德國一家非常大的游戲服務器提供商 GPORTAL 租用 Minecraft 服務器。
創(chuàng)建一個帳戶
為了在 GPORTAL 創(chuàng)建和管理您的游戲服務器,需要一個用戶帳戶。如果尚未完成,請在https://www.g-portal.com/de/register創(chuàng)建一個
選擇服務器計劃:
單擊左側“產(chǎn)品”下的“我的世界”后,您可以選擇服務器計劃或創(chuàng)建自定義配置。

在此示例中,我將選擇通過單擊相關按鈕來創(chuàng)建自定義配置。

我將在頂部下拉菜單中選擇“Minecraft Vanilla”,使用滑塊選擇 2GB RAM,并選擇 3 天作為持續(xù)時間。?對于可用位置,請選擇一個盡可能靠近您所在位置的位置,以便與服務器建立良好連接。?重要提示:我選擇了最低的 RAM 和持續(xù)時間設置,因為這只是一個測試服務器,我不會在上面玩?,F(xiàn)在點擊“繼續(xù)”繼續(xù)您的 Minecraft 服務器訂單
選擇付款方式
GPORTAL 提供多種支付方式(取決于您所在的位置),例如信用卡、PayPal 等。

在這個例子中,我將用我的余額支付——然后點擊“訂購”
激活您的服務器
單擊“訂購”后,將彈出此菜單,您可以在其中選擇是現(xiàn)在還是稍后激活服務器。請記?。阂坏┠c擊“立即激活”,持續(xù)時間計數(shù)器就會開始計時。

現(xiàn)在單擊“轉到服務器配置”以訪問服務器的儀表板:

恭喜!您租用的 Minecraft 服務器已啟動并正在運行,您可以開始與朋友一起玩了。
結論
總之,設置 Minecraft 服務器是一種有趣且有益的體驗。無論您選擇在您的 PC 或遠程服務器上自行托管,還是租用已經(jīng)準備好的 Minecraft 服務器,本終極指南都為您提供了該過程的全面概述。我們涵蓋了從安裝和配置 Linux 服務器到在服務器上設置 Minecraft 的所有內(nèi)容。
在 VPS 上自行托管 Minecraft 服務器可以讓您完全控制您的服務器,并且比租用托管 Minecraft 服務器更便宜。但是,它需要技術知識并且維護起來可能很耗時。當您嘗試在家中自己的 PC 上執(zhí)行此操作時,它會變得更加困難。租用現(xiàn)成的 Minecrafta 服務器可以輕松無憂,并提供技術支持和可擴展性選項。但是,它可能更昂貴并且會限制您對服務器的控制。
最終,自行托管或租用服務器的決定取決于您的需求和預算。無論您選擇哪個選項,我們都希望這份終極指南為您提供了必要的知識和工具,為您和您的朋友創(chuàng)建完美的 Minecraft 服務器。所以,拿起你的鎬,戴上你的頭盔,潛入令人興奮的 Minecraft 服務器世界。在本指南的幫助下,您將很快上手并運行!